Legendary retired tennis player Serena Williams has taken to Twitter sharing a picture of herself cuddling with her youngest daughter Adira River after confessing that she wasn’t doing well.

‘I’M NOT OK TODAY’

In a post to Twitter Serena Williams showed off the sweet moment with a precious photo of her three-month-old daughter resting on her chest in a blue polka-dot blanket.

“This makes me so happy”; Serena captioned the pic.

Desoite basking in joy, a few hours before sharing the picture on Twitter Serena got vulnerable on the social media platform about her mental health. The tennis player opened up about having a rough day.

“I am not ok today. And that’s ok to not be ok. No one is ok every single day. If you are not ok today, I’m with you”, she shared in a tweet.

Williams continued: “There’s always tomorrow”. Love you”.
